Offered here is a beautiful vintage hand-painted Indian canvas painting, created in the Rajasthani folk art tradition, likely from the Nathdwara or Kishangarh school. The scene depicts Lord Krishna with the gopis (cowherd maidens), celebrating with joy beneath stylized flowering trees, framed with a decorative border. The blue-skinned Krishna is richly adorned with crown, jewelry, and flowing garments, while the gopis wear traditional saris with pearl-like jewelry.
